Relocating a Hurry? 6 Tips for a Last Minute Move

In a best world, you 'd have ample time to prepare for any move that you have to make. Moving is a process rife with individual tasks and tiny details, and 3 or 4 weeks, at minimum, is usually chosen for doing it right. But in the real life, life comes at you fast, therefore does a last minute move.

There are two main types of rushed moves. There are the ones where you don't have a lot of lead time in between finding out you have to move and the move itself, and then the ones where you put things off simply a bit too much and find yourself gazing at an entirely unpacked house a couple days before the movers are set to show up.

Start with the logistics
A last minute relocation has a method of making every job seem both utterly challenging and imminently needed to achieve. It's simple to feel paralyzed by just how much requirements to get done, however rather of letting your moving to-dos overwhelm you, simply take a deep breath and get to work crossing items off of the list.

Your first step is going to be either hiring a moving company or renting a truck, depending on if you're going to require expert assist with your relocation or you're preparing to do it yourself. If you are utilizing movers, you won't have much time to do research, so use a tool like our moving company directory to rapidly discover a list of reputable movers in your location. If you're leasing a truck, get quotes from two or 3 companies and after that make a decision immediately. The earlier you have the logistics of your move sorted out, the faster you can get to work on whatever else.

Get rid of the important things you don't require
The less you have to pack, the easier packaging will be. And with a last minute move, easy packaging is essential.

Believe practicality, not sentimentality. A relocation is a good time to modify down your things, and a rushed move provides you much more reward to travel lightly. Once you're unpacking in your new home, withstand the desire to simply pack everything with the concept that you'll get rid of things. It's much easier to arrange these products out pre-move and conserve your time and energy for the important things that really matter.

When your piles are arranged, get rid of them. Used linens and towels can be dropped off at your regional animal shelter, while unopened, unexpired www.crunchbase.com/organization/moveon-moving food (especially canned food) will go a long way at your regional food pantry.

Have furnishings or other large products you 'd like to contribute? Head to Donation Town, enter your zip code, and you'll discover a list of nearby charities who will come choose up carefully used furniture and family items.

Do not check here believe, pack
Packing in a hurry needs a little less deference paid to company and a little bit more paid to just getting whatever in a box and setting it aside. The objective here is to get all of your things from your present home to your brand-new one intact, and if a short time frame suggests that you can't efficiently sort items or keep an itemized list of what's loaded where, so be it. Instead, keep your eye on the reward and follow these packaging tips for relocating a hurry:

Load now and sort later. Put things where they fit, even if it suggests packing the water glasses with the board video games and the extra light bulbs with the contents of your filing cabinet.
Use soft items like towels and socks to wrap breakables. Fill two requirements with one deed by covering breakable products like vases and glassware in soft items you require to load anyhow, such as socks, towels, and clothing. As a benefit, you'll likewise save money on packing materials.
Establish boxes as you require them. Keep your area as clear and manageable as possible by only setting up boxes as you're prepared to fill them. As soon as a box is filled, tape it up, move it out of the method, and established a new one.
Save yourself a load of time and boxes by loading up clothing as they already are. Keep dresser drawers undamaged and merely get here rid of each drawer and cover it in packing materials or keep the whole cabinets as is (offered it's not too heavy to move).
Ask for aid
Moving is a huge task, particularly when it has actually to get done quickly, and it's completely all right to turn to your friends or family for some assisting hands. Genuinely time consuming tasks like packing up your kitchen area cabinets and getting products dropped off for donation become considerably more easy when you have actually got another individual (or persons) helping you out.
